Dr. Seuss's SEUSSICAL... "Horton Hears A Who"

See the world of Dr. Seuss come to life on stage! This hit Broadway musical follows the adventures of Horton the Elephant who hears a "Who". Narrated by Cat in the Hat, you meet all your favorite Seuss characters.. Who would have thunk you could find such a think in the Hurrah Players?

HOLIDAYS IN VIRGINIA

In the style of Radio City Music Hall, it's Hurrah for the holidays! A lively musical revue featuring precision kick-line dancers, holiday classics from yesterday and today, a celebration of all faiths and special visit from Mr. & Mrs. Claus!

THE BEST CHRISTMAS PAGEANT EVER

Back by popular demand for the 16th year! A funny and touching story based on the popular book by Barbara Robinson. Watch as the unruly Herdman children learn the true meaning of Christmas.

HONK!

Hans Christian Andersen's classic tale "The Ugly Duckling" has been transformed into a modern musical comedy for all ages. From the moment 'Ugly' is hatched, the show brims with charm, witty lyrics, a cast of memorable characters and a moral purpose that spans every generation.
